3步掌握DREAM3D:材料科学数据分析终极指南
你是否正在寻找一款能够处理复杂材料科学数据的强大工具?DREAM3D作为基于SIMPL框架的开源数据分析平台,为材料科学家提供了从数据采集到三维可视化的一站式解决方案。这款跨平台软件不仅支持多维数据处理,还能帮助用户重建微结构、进行定量分析,是材料研发过程中不可或缺的得力助手。
🚀 快速部署:两种方式任你选择
方案一:预编译版本直装
直接获取官方编译好的二进制文件是最快捷的方式。根据你的操作系统下载对应版本,解压即用,无需复杂的编译过程。
方案二:Anaconda环境安装
对于Python开发者而言,通过conda环境安装更加灵活:
conda config --add channels conda-forge
conda create -n dream3d python=3.7
conda activate dream3d
conda install -c http://dream3d.bluequartz.net/binaries/conda dream3d-conda
完成环境配置后,你就能在Python中直接调用DREAM3D的各种滤波器功能了!
🔬 核心功能实战:从入门到精通
微结构三维重建全流程
微结构重建示意图
通过DREAM3D的滤波器组合,你可以轻松完成从原始数据到三维微结构的完整重建:
- 数据预处理:使用清理扫描滤波器去除噪声
- 晶粒分割:应用晶粒分割算法识别不同晶粒
- 统计分析:获取晶粒尺寸和取向分布数据
合成材料模拟生成
DREAM3D的合成构建模块让你能够创建复杂的多相材料结构,这些结构可以直接用于有限元仿真分析。
📊 生态系统深度集成
DREAM3D的强大之处在于其与主流科学计算工具的完美融合:
-
ParaView可视化:将DREAM3D生成的数据无缝导入ParaView进行高级可视化
-
HDF5数据格式:采用标准HDF5格式存储,确保与其他科学应用的兼容性 数据分析界面
-
ITK图像处理:集成Insight Toolkit,提供更丰富的图像分析能力
💡 最佳实践与技巧分享
新手避坑指南
- 从简单的示例管道开始,逐步掌握滤波器组合
- 充分利用项目中的预构建管道文件作为学习模板
- 定期检查数据质量,确保每个处理步骤的正确性
进阶应用场景
无论是学术研究还是工业应用,DREAM3D都能在材料定量分析、性能预测和微结构设计等方面发挥重要作用。
通过本指南,你已经掌握了DREAM3D的核心使用方法和应用技巧。现在就开始你的材料科学数据分析之旅吧!🚀
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



